Content Infrastructure
As a backend engineer on the Content Infrastructure Team, you'll build features that make up the core backbone of the learning experience on Duolingo. Our short-form lessons are where learners spend the majority of their time on the app, and our team's mission is to build and update infrastructure to enable quick iteration and improve content quality in these sessions.
You'll work on scaling new exercise types that support our learners in practicing speaking or grammar in bite-sized formats, as well as re-architecting our infrastructure in other ways to help set our teams up for success in the future. We're looking for engineers who are passionate about designing scalable systems to help improve the quality of our short-form sessions!

Fraud Warning: Unfortunately, there is a rise in scammers pretending to be real Duolingo employees. Duolingo and our employees will never ask for your Social Security number, bank details, or passport info, and we'll never ask you to deposit a check, purchase equipment, or exchange money during the interview process. Real Duolingo employees always use an email that ends in @duolingo.com or @recruiting.duolingo.com. Stay alert and double-check these details before sharing any information.
